| I looked at some headers (a friend of mine) once, there were 26 addresses on it - CASmith thru CZSmith. And I have seen the same thing on two of my accounts that use initials and last name. Nothing like a sequential name generator to get full coverage. -- I am not lost, I find myself every time. |
